The Three-Layer Testing Framework for Voice AI: Regression, Adversarial, and Production-Derived
Blog post from Coval
Achieving high production success rates in voice AI systems requires a systematic approach to testing, which involves a three-layer framework: regression testing, adversarial testing, and production-derived testing. Unlike traditional software testing, voice AI testing must account for the infinite variability of user interactions, including accents, audio quality, and conversation patterns. Regression testing ensures core functionalities remain intact after updates, adversarial testing explores unknown scenarios to preemptively identify failures, and production-derived testing leverages real conversation insights to continuously improve the system. Each layer has specific methodologies and cadences for execution, and together they form a robust framework that systematically enhances voice AI performance. Consistent AI agent evaluation criteria and voice debugging capabilities are essential for understanding and resolving test failures, with the framework offering a structured approach to building reliable and adaptable voice AI solutions.
